设为首页 加入收藏

TOP

python数据库-MySQL数据库高级查询操作(51)(四)
2019-07-11 18:10:45 】 浏览:150
Tags:python 数据库 -MySQL 高级 查询 操作
类型必须是innodb或bdb类型,才可以对此表使用事务
  • 查看表的创建语句
  • show create table Stu_score;
    • 修改表的类型:alter table '表名' engine=innodb;
    alter table Stu_score engine=innodb;
    • 事务语句
    开启begin;
    提交commit;
    回滚rollback;

      在begin;后面写我们要操作的SQL语句组合也就是我们所谓的要执行的事物,但是这个时候写好的SQL语句就算我们回车之后,也不会执行,知道commit;执行之后才会被执行到数据库中,rollback回滚是我们begin;之后发现我们写错了,或者不想执行了,都可以在commit;之前回滚到上一次commit;的状态,很像版本控制器SVN和GIT一样

    首页 上一页 1 2 3 4 下一页 尾页 4/4/4
    】【打印繁体】【投稿】【收藏】 【推荐】【举报】【评论】 【关闭】 【返回顶部
    上一篇英文字母和中文汉字在不同字符集.. 下一篇ORM:对象关系映射

    最新文章

    热门文章

    Hot 文章

    Python

    C 语言

    C++基础

    大数据基础

    linux编程基础

    C/C++面试题目